Positioned within easy walking distance of the train and bus stations, as well as the Lake itself, Adam Place allows guests to enjoy both accessibility and tranquillity. Ample street parking is also available, with no restrictions or fees, adding further ease to any stay.
The accommodation comprises five well-appointed bedrooms, catering for double, family, twin and single guests. Each room is fully en-suite and comfortably furnished, with thoughtful touches including a hospitality tray and colour television, ensuring a relaxing and convenient environment.
The dining experience is equally distinctive. The dining room features a tasteful 1960s theme, complete with white linen table covers and matching crockery. Guests can choose from a wide and varied breakfast menu, beginning with fruit juices, fresh fruit and cereals, followed by a selection of traditional, vegetarian or continental options. All dishes are home-cooked and prepared to suit individual tastes.
After a day spent hillwalking, touring the surrounding area, or simply enjoying time by the Lake, guests can unwind in the garden as the sun sets. It provides the perfect opportunity to relax and reflect on the unique beauty and tranquillity of the Lake District.
